WebThe greatest common factor of integers a and b is the largest positive number that is divisible by both a and b without a remainder. How to find GCF? To find the GCF of two numbers list the factors of each number. Then mark the common factors in both lists. WebThe Greatest Common Factor (GCF) for 5, 6 and 10, notation CGF (5,6,10), is 1. Explanation: The factors of 5 are 1,5; The factors of 6 are 1,2,3,6; The factors of 10 are 1,2,5,10. So, as we can see, the Greatest Common Factor or Divisor is 1, because it is the greatest number that divides evenly into all of them. WebHow to Find the GCF of 6 and 10? Answer: Greatest Common Factor of 6 and 10 = 2. Step 1: Find the prime factorization of 6. 6 = 2 x 3. WebDivide both the numerator and the denominator by the GCF. Using the steps above, here is the work involved in the solution for fraction 6/10 to simplest form. The greatest common factor (GCF) of the numerator (6) and the denominator (10) is 2.
